At the art of motion Academy, we are excited to offer you this comprehensive manual for embodied learning. Slings in Motion Blend comprises a diverse mix of exercise favourites from the Slings in Motion I, II, and III repertoire series. Special features of the fascia-focussed movement selection are: All of the 12 myofascial meridians of Tom Myers' Anatomy Trains concept are considered with specificity. All of the 12 Fascial Movement Qualities of the Slings Myofascial Training concept are deliberately utilised and improved. Exercises in all body positions are included (standing, weight-bearing, kneeling, sitting, prone, side-lying, supine). The versatility of the repertoire unites dynamic exercises with slow, deliberate motions and melting poses. All exercises can be embedded into the smooth flowing SynerChi sequence shown at the end of the manual. Each of the 20 exercises is illustrated with photos that show every phase of a motion. The detailed descriptions include: Overarching exercise aims Distinct exercise benefits Use of props such as the Slings massage balls, massage domes, trigger balls, and kneeling pad Recommended breathing pattern and technique Movement sequence from starting position to execution to conclusion Applied Slings Myofascial Training Techniques Key points to remember Specific instructions for each movement component Myofascial movement anatomy Exercise variations Every exercise in this manual has a multitude of benefits for your body and the way you feel in your body. In Anatomy Trains in Motion, the integral Anatomy Trains «map of connection» is translated into a tangible and productive application for movement training. Whether you're seeking an initial introduction to the detail of the anatomy of the myofascial meridians or you're ready for movement-relevant understanding of the interrelatedness of the lines, you'll find this to be a helpful guide. If you are a movement professional or therapist attending Anatomy Trains in Motion anywhere in the world, then this study guide is, alongside the course manual, a practical learning tool. With detailed maps of each of the Anatomy Trains lines, training aims and considerations specific to each line, recommended movement sequences to enhance fascial movement qualities, and supportive ways to embody your learning, the study guide for myofascial meridian anatomy will take you along a detailed yet integrated and embodied path toward movement ease.

Instead, Slings Essentials offers you a tried and tested Resource-Oriented Integrative Movement concept that is supported by current research. In addition to the exercise examples shown in each chapter, there are references to the Slings Essentials Embodiment video library (https://vimeo.com/ondemand/slingsessentials), which contains 12 fascia-focussed movement practices and accompanying short stories. The centrepiece of this book is the 'Slings Trinity'. It comprises 3 interrelated components that comprehensively describe the 'why' and 'how' of 'what' you do in practice. The supporting chapters give you an insight into fascial anatomy, including a practical Skin to Bone Layering Model, the 6 Guiding Principles and the 8 Teaching Principles of Slings, as well as a definition of movement as a holistic synergy. Slings Essentials is a manual for embodied learning. It is designed for inquisitive professionals and movers who want to understand and experience the dimensions of a Resource-Oriented Integrative Movement practice that utilises fascia as a medium to bring out the best in the body.
